Over the past year, we’ve been working hard to reduce our energy consumption by 10%, to recycle more across our operation and – most importantly – reduce our own food waste.
By working more closely with local community food initiatives, we now donate all usable food that we can’t sell to help others and all waste food and drink items are sent to anaerobic digestion instead of landfill; to help make green energy for the grid. We also help our customers to recycle their waste cardboard and cooking oil - helping them to improve their carbon footprint, too.

The Hotel Folk Limited is a group of six distinctive hotels situated on the coast or within the Suffolk countryside. These include The Brudenell and The White Lion in Aldeburgh, Thorpeness Golf Club & Hotel, The Crown and Castle in Orford, The Crown in Woodbridge and the 15th century Swan Hotel and Spa in Lavenham. Each offer a unique charm of their own; boasting superb accommodation and excellent dining, set in some of the county’s most outstanding locations.
The Hotel Folk, previously known as the TA Hotel Collection, underwent a full rebrand and relaunch in 2019 under the helm of, now CEO, David Scott. Included within this transition, was a £500,000 investment in IT and dynamic marketing systems which included redesigned websites for the group and each individual hotel, a new booking system to centralise room and restaurant reservations and a centralised food and liquor procurement procedure.
In addition, a huge focus on investment in people has driven the vision of the business in the last four years and witnessed the creation of a bespoke training facility as well as intranet ‘Folklore’, that has helped produce some of the very best departments within the industry.

Woodforde’s Brewery has been brewing with passion since 1981. Located in the Norfolk village of Woodbastwick, Woodforde’s is the largest brewery in the county. Since its foundation, Woodforde’s has produced numerous award-winning beers which have become the drink of choice for many. The brewery is famed for its Supreme Champion Beer of Britain amber ale, Wherry, named after the iconic boats which still sail The Broads today. The brewery’s use of the finest local and international ingredients has led it to develop numerous delicious beers and cyders, from its American IPA, Volt, to its cyder with a bite, Norfolk Adder.
Woodforde’s prides itself on the passion and quality put into every pint, and its team of expert brewers are behind the deliciousness in every drop. As a local brewery, Woodforde’s is committed to supporting its community and celebrating Norfolk, as well as the wider East of England, for the quality drinks it produces. Woodforde’s Brewery owns two pubs; its brewery tap The Fur & Feather, and The Lord Nelson, the former watering hole of the Admiral himself.
